What is a Song Quiz?
A song quiz is a game where participants identify songs based on short audio clips. These clips can be intros, choruses, verses, or even instrumental sections. The goal is to be the first (or among the first) to correctly identify the song title and, sometimes, the artist. Song quizzes come in various formats, from traditional pen-and-paper quizzes to interactive online games and apps.

Different Types of Song Quizzes
Song quizzes aren’t a ‘one size fits all’ activity. The variation keeps it exciting, so it helps to familiarize yourself with common types:
* **Classic Intro Quizzes:** This is the most common type, where you identify a song based on its opening seconds.
* **Chorus Quizzes:** These quizzes focus on the most recognizable part of the song – the chorus.
* **Instrumental Quizzes:** These quizzes require you to identify a song based on its instrumental sections, often challenging even seasoned music lovers.
* **Lyrics Quizzes:** Instead of audio clips, you’re given a set of lyrics and must identify the song.
* **Mixed Quizzes:** A combination of different question types, offering a diverse challenge.
* **Themed Quizzes:** Quizzes focused on a specific genre (e.g., 80s music, pop, rock), artist, or era.
* **Picture Quizzes:** These quizzes may incorporate picture clues related to the artist or song.
* **Reverse Quizzes:** You are given the song title and asked to identify the artist.

Hosting Your Own Song Quiz: The Ultimate Entertainment
Ready to put your knowledge to the test and create your own musical challenge? Here’s how to host a killer song quiz:
1. **Choose a Theme (Optional):** Decide whether you want to have a specific theme for your quiz (e.g., 80s music, movie soundtracks, pop). This can make the quiz more engaging and focused.
2. **Select Your Music:**
* **Variety is Key:** Choose a variety of songs from different genres, eras, and artists. This will ensure that there’s something for everyone.
* **Balance Difficulty:** Strike a balance between easy, medium, and difficult questions. This will keep the quiz challenging but not frustrating.
* **Consider Your Audience:** Take into account the musical tastes of your audience when selecting your songs.
* **Clear Audio Quality:** Ensure the audio clips you use are of good quality. Distorted or low-quality audio can make it difficult to identify the songs.
3. **Create Your Question Format:**
* **Multiple Choice:** Multiple-choice questions can be easier for participants, especially if they’re not familiar with all the songs.
* **Open-Ended:** Open-ended questions require participants to write down the song title and artist. This is more challenging but can also be more rewarding.
* **Mix and Match:** Combine different question formats to keep the quiz interesting.
* **Bonus Points:** Consider awarding bonus points for identifying additional information about the song, such as the year it was released or the album it appeared on.
4. **Prepare Your Equipment:**
* **Sound System:** Ensure you have a good sound system that can play the audio clips clearly.
* **Projector and Screen (Optional):** If you’re using a visual element, such as a slideshow of album covers, you’ll need a projector and screen.
* **Answer Sheets:** Prepare answer sheets for participants to write down their answers.
* **Pens/Pencils:** Provide pens or pencils for participants.
5. **Set the Rules:**
* **Individual vs. Team:** Decide whether participants will play individually or in teams.
* **Time Limit:** Set a time limit for each question.
* **No Phones:** Prohibit the use of phones or other devices during the quiz.
* **Scoring System:** Explain the scoring system clearly.
6. **Run the Quiz:**
* **Introduce the Quiz:** Start by introducing the quiz and explaining the rules.
* **Play the Audio Clips:** Play the audio clips clearly and at a consistent volume.
* **Monitor the Participants:** Monitor the participants to ensure that they’re following the rules.
* **Collect the Answer Sheets:** Collect the answer sheets at the end of each round.
* **Tally the Scores:** Tally the scores and announce the winner(s).
